How much salt is in Kerry salted butter?

3 min read
According to the official Kerrygold USA website, Kerrygold salted butter contains 100mg of sodium per tablespoon. This translates to a rich 1.8% salt content by weight when looking at European nutritional labels, a significant fact for cooks and those monitoring their intake.

Is Salted Butter OK for Keto? Navigating the Sodium and Macros

4 min read
According to nutrition databases, both salted and unsalted butter contain a negligible amount of carbohydrates, typically less than 0.1 grams per tablespoon. This makes butter a viable high-fat, low-carb food for those on a ketogenic diet. The main distinction for keto dieters is the added sodium.

How much salt is in a stick of Challenge salted butter?

4 min read
According to Challenge Dairy's nutritional information, a single stick of their salted butter contains 720 milligrams of sodium. This is a crucial detail for bakers seeking precise control over their recipes and for individuals monitoring their sodium intake, as the salt content in a stick of Challenge salted butter is equivalent to approximately one-quarter teaspoon.
